Summary

ELI-002 is Elicio Therapeutics' lymph-node-targeted vaccine against mutant KRAS/NRAS — the mutation driving the large majority of pancreatic cancers and a meaningful share of colorectal and other GI cancers — designed to concentrate the immune response in lymph nodes rather than at the injection site. Its two active trials are testing a broadened 7-peptide version (ELI-002 7P, covering more KRAS/NRAS mutation variants than the original 2-peptide formulation), both alone and combined with tislelizumab, an anti-PD-1 checkpoint inhibitor.

An earlier expanded-access protocol is now listed no-longer-available, and the completed original 2-peptide Phase I established the approach's safety in pancreatic cancer specifically — the broadened 7P version now being tested is what's actually recruiting.

NCT07671339 A Study of ELI-002 7P, With or Without Tislelizumab, in People With Pancreatic Cancer Phase I Recruiting 2026-06-22

The researchers are doing this study to find out whether ELI-002 7P in combination with mFOLFIRINOX, with or without tislelizumab, is a safe treatment approach in people who have pancreatic ductal adenocarcinoma (PDAC) with a KRAS mutation. In addition, the researchers are doing this study to find out whether the study treatment is effective against PDAC.

NCT05726864 A Study of ELI-002 7P in Subjects With KRAS/NRAS Mutated Solid Tumors Phase I, Phase II Active, not recruiting 2023-04-14

This is a Phase 1/2 study to assess the safety and efficacy of ELI-002 7P immunotherapy (a lipid-conjugated immune-stimulatory oligonucleotide \[Amph-CpG-7909\] plus a mixture of lipid-conjugated peptide-based antigens \[Amph-Peptides 7P\]) as adjuvant treatment in subjects with solid tumors with mutated KRAS/NRAS. This study builds on the experience obtained with related product ELI-002 2P, which was studied in protocol ELI-002-001 under IND 26909.

NCT04853017 A Study of ELI-002 in Subjects With KRAS Mutated Pancreatic Ductal Adenocarcinoma (PDAC) and Other Solid Tumors Phase I Completed 2021-10-04

This is a Phase 1 study to assess the safety and efficacy of ELI-002 immunotherapy (a lipid-conjugated immune-stimulatory oligonucleotide \[Amph-CpG-7909\] plus a mixture of lipid-conjugated peptide-based antigens \[Amph-Peptides\]) as adjuvant treatment of minimal residual disease (MRD) in subjects with KRAS/neuroblastoma ras viral oncogene homolog (NRAS) mutated PDAC or other solid tumors.

NCT07083479 Expanded Access Protocol of ELI-002-102 in Subjects With KRAS/NRAS Mutated Pancreatic Ductal Adenocarcinoma N/A No_Longer_Available

This is an open-label expanded access protocol (EAP) of ELI-002 7P immunotherapy (a lipid-conjugated immune-stimulatory oligonucleotide \[Amph-CpG-7909\] plus a mixture of lipid-conjugated peptide-based antigens \[Amph-Peptides 7P\]) as adjuvant treatment in patients with KRAS/NRAS-mutated pancreatic ductal adenocarcinoma who are at high risk for relapse (ie, presence of isolated tumor cells in a patient whose primary tumor has been removed and is currently without clinical signs of disease). This protocol builds on the experience being obtained with ELI-002 7P (with Amph-Peptides G12D, G12R, G12V, G12A, G12C, G12S, G13D), which is being studied in protocol ELI-002-201.
